This paper examines fully developed laminar flow and conjugated forced convection heat transfer in curved rectangular channels. The wall average Nusselt number, <(Nu)over bar>, is presented as a function of the wall conduction parameter, phi, the Dean number, De, and the channel aspect ratio, lambda. Secondary flow streamlines for the case of lambda=1/2 are presented to illustrate the enhanced stability in curved rectangular channels in comparison with curved square channels. A curve illustrating the relationship between phi(eff), defined as the value of phi at which a constant wall temperature boundary condition can be assumed, and De is presented for several values of lambda. The solution for straight channels is also included, and it is found that phi(eff) is independent of lambda for lambda less than or equal to 1/4.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ved.
